Booking a Program at the MoD

The MoD offers a range of on-site programs for children’s groups. Organizers can build their preferred schedule for a half day, full day or evening program by choosing from the activities below. 

Program Formats

Half-Day Program: Choose one to three of the thirty minute activities and/or choose zero to one of the one hour activities.

Full-Day Program: Choose one to six of the thirty minute activities and/or choose one to three of the one hour activities.

Evening Program: Available upon request, contact the education team to discuss suitable programs.

Explore our Activities

Educational Activities

30 minutes | Suitable for 6+

Historic Games – Try out a range of historic children’s games

Historic Tools – See if you can identify historic artefacts

Dufferin House – Explore our Early Settler log cabin c.1860

Historic Crafts

30 minutes | Suitable for 6+ | Takeaway Component

Tin Punching – Try the historic craft of tin punching

Clay Pinch Pots – Learn to shape your own clay pinch pot

Three Sisters – Plant the Three Sisters and learn about their significance

Heritage Crafts

1 Hour | Suitable for 9+ | Takeaway Component

Candle Making – Learn about historic candle making then craft your own

Soap Making – Explore Early Settler soap use and create your own soap

Knitting or Crochet – Learn the basic skills of crochet or knitting

Art Zone

1 Hour | Suitable for 9+ | Takeaway Component

Glass Painting – Learn about historic stained glass and paint your own

Polymer Clay Magnets – Make your own unique clay magnet

Botanical Printing – Create botanical prints with natural materials

Further Information

Cost: Program fees start at $7 + HST per participant, adults and/or carers are free.

  • We request an adult to child ratio of 1:8, additional adults will be charged general admission.
  • The prices of our 1 hour activities may vary by supply costs, our team will provide up-to-date quotes.

Suitable Age Range: 6-18 years
